Warning About Recent Beta Redsn0w untethered Jailbreak For IOS 4.2.1


The Dev Team released RedSn0w 0.9.7b1 this morning, an untethered jailbreak for iPad, iPhone 4 and iPod Touch 4G on iOS 4.2.1. When we first reported about this updated version of RedSn0w, we advised you not to use because it is still in beta, and most importantly, comes with a few issues worth mentioning.

We still think that you should hold off and be patient. A more stable version should be released soon. In the meanwhile, if you are curious about what problems you might encounter after “untethering” your iPhone, here are some of the issues that have been reported:

* Bluetooth is disabled
* iPod player doesn’t work on the iPhone 4 or the iPad
* Application Switcher will crash your iPhone
* YouTube won’t work
* Videos from the camera roll won’t play
* AirPlay won’t work
* Some App Store apps not working

If you rely on an unlock for your iPhone, you should definitely stay away from this untethered jailbreak for the time being.
